Miserable Sporting Lagos in soup after heaviest defeat in NPFL history
Newcomers Sporting Lagos have suffered their worst defeat in the Nigerian Premier Football League, NPFL, history, falling 4-1 to Rivers United in a one-sided affair in Port Harcourt.
The Tech Boys, still searching for their first away win of the season, were blown away by the attacking prowess of the former league champions, with Andy Okpe leading the charge for the home side.

It was Rivers United who drew first blood, with Nwangwa Nyima opening the scoring for the home side with a good finish just before the half-hour mark.
However, Sporting Lagos managed to equalise before the break, as Tobechukwu converted a penalty to level the scores at the interval.
But the second half belonged entirely to Rivers United, as Okpe took the game by the scruff of the neck, bagging a brilliant brace to put the result beyond doubt.
Any hopes the visitors had for a fightback was completely shut down when Seiye Jackson added a fourth late on to cap a miserable outing for Sporting Lagos.

The defeat marks the heaviest loss ever suffered by Sporting Lagos in the NPFL, coming under the guidance of new boss Abdullahi Biffo.
The result has also seen the Tech Boys drop perilously close to the relegation zone, sitting just one point above the danger area.
Sporting Lagos will now turn their attention to a daunting home clash against league leaders Rangers International, as they look to bounce back from this disastrous defeat.
